Thermoplastic injection Molds

The thermoplastic injection molding process involves injecting molten plastic into a closed mold cavity under high pressure. Once the plastic cools and solidifies, it takes the shape of the mold cavity, resulting in a precision-made product. The success of this process largely depends on the quality and design of the injection mold.

Thermoplastic injection Molds

The design of a thermoplastic injection mold is a complex and meticulous task. It requires careful consideration of the product’s geometry, material properties, and manufacturing constraints. The mold designer must ensure that the mold cavity accurately replicates the desired shape while also accounting for factors such as shrinkage, warping, and other potential defects. In addition to the mold cavity, the injection mold also includes several other components such as the gate, runner system, and cooling channels. The gate controls the flow of molten plastic into the mold cavity, while the runner system ensures uniform distribution of the plastic. The cooling channels, on the other hand, help accelerate the cooling process, allowing for faster cycle times and improved product quality.
